Transaction 402c35c7963443ce77c8f03304fa4f351c7953623a7bc881b2d6c55f72c6eff3
1 Input
1 Output
-
402c35c7963443ce77c8f03304fa4f351c7953623a7bc881b2d6c55f72c6eff3:0
- value
- 170236269
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7bff2f0de642a4e75b95ad5d5e9f02feb4342259 OP_EQUAL
- address
- 3CzejcwpcuznhN6sYiCHT6ijMSAr7Qgfwq